Mixed Greens Strawberry Salad
Course: Salad
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Total Time: 15 minutes
Yield: 2
Calories: 279kcal

Dressing
- 2 tsp honey
- ¼ cup balsamic vinegar
- 1 Tbsp extra virgin olive oil
- ¼ tsp table salt
- ¼ tsp pepper
Salad
- 2 cups field greens or lettuce of choice
- ½ cucumber sliced
- 1 carrot julienned
- 5 medium California strawberries stemmed and halved
- 2 Tbsp goat cheese
- ¼ cup pistachios chopped
Instructions
- In small bowl, whisk together the honey, balsamic vinegar, olive oil, salt & pepper; set aside.
- After preparing and chopping all salad ingredients, add a layer of greens to the bottom of a shallow serving dish.
- Arrange cucumbers, carrot slices and strawberries on top of lettuce.
- Garnish with goat cheese and pistachios, and drizzle dressing over the top.
Nutrition
Serving: 0.5 Salad | Calories: 279kcal | Carbohydrates: 26g | Protein: 7g | Fat: 17g | Saturated Fat: 4g | Cholesterol: 7mg | Sodium: 440mg | Fiber: 5g | Sugar: 17g | Vitamin C: 42mg
